Although Pontypool & New Inn may not boast extensive facilities, it does provide essential services for travellers. While there is no ticket office, 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ting tickets. These machines cater to various payment methods, though it's important to note that cash is not accepted. Worried about access and support? The station is equipped with customer help points for immediate assistance at platforms and a help point for more extensive inquiries. Unfortunately, step-free access is limited due to a flight of 24 steps leading to the platforms, so travellers with mobility challenges should plan accordingly.
If you are someone who enjoys cycling, you'll be happy to know there are 14 cycle parking spaces available, spread across two locations for your convenience. However, the station lacks amenities like toilets, waiting rooms, and refreshment facilities. On the security side, there is CCTV monitoring to ensure passenger safety.
Though options are somewhat limited, transport links to and from Pontypool & New Inn station keep it connected to the broader area. A rail replacement bus service is available, and there's a PlusBus option that offers discounted bus travel in Pontypool. Details of these options are accessible via the PlusBus website. Additionally, while bicycle hire is not available directly at the station, bringing your bicycle is made easy with the existing storage facilities.

One of St Albans Abbey's standout features is the accessibility it provides. With step-free access to all platforms, the station is user-friendly for passengers with reduced mobility or those carrying heavy luggage. Tickets can be conveniently obtained from the ticket vending machines available on Platform One. Additionally, there is an induction loop system for the hearing impaired, ensuring that everyone's journey can start without unnecessary fuss.
While the station lacks some amenities such as ATMs, waiting rooms, and refreshment facilities, it compensates with its security features. Accredited by the Secure Station Scheme, passengers can feel safe as they travel. Although there are no staff help available on-site, customer help points ensure assistance is always within reach. The absence of facilities like luggage storage and accessible toilets is a consideration, yet the station's comfort and efficiency in other respects make it a reliable transit point.
When it comes to onward travel, St Albans Abbey station is well-connected. For those needing alternative transport during rail disruptions, a rail replacement service operates nearby. Buses to Watford depart from bus stop A on A5183 Holywell Hill, while services to St Albans leave from bus stop B. Furthermore, St Albans Abbey provides connections to London's airports. Change at Watford Junction for trains to Gatwick, or use the regular 'Green Line' bus service 724 from the St Albans Station interchange to Heathrow.
